Suppressed Police Statement Reveals Allegations Against Former ACT Politician

SITUATION
A formerly suppressed police statement has brought to light serious allegations against Gordon Ramsay, a former attorney-general of the Australian Capital Territory (ACT). The statement accuses Ramsay of grooming a teenage boy over a period spanning from 2022 to 2024.

Brief

According to court documents, Ramsay allegedly used dinners, alcohol, and affirmations of the boy's specialness as part of his grooming tactics. The allegations further claim that Ramsay requested increasingly sexualised images from the boy. Ramsay, who is 61 years old, has been charged with one count of encouraging a young person to commit an act of a sexual nature.

He has pleaded not guilty to the charge. The case came to the attention of law enforcement after a complaint was filed, leading to Ramsay's arrest in October of the previous year. The revelations have sparked significant public interest, given Ramsay's former role as a prominent political figure in the ACT.
